Kaizer Chiefs, AmaZulu and Al Ahly Target Tshegofatso Mabasa Ahead of Free Agency Move

Introduction

The upcoming transfer window is already generating momentum, with several clubs preparing to strengthen their squads ahead of the new season. One of the names attracting significant attention is striker Tshegofatso Mabasa, whose contract situation is set to make him a free agent.

With interest from top clubs including Kaizer Chiefs, AmaZulu FC, and Al Ahly SC, Mabasa could become one of the most talked-about moves in the next transfer window.


What Is Happening With Mabasa?

Tshegofatso Mabasa is currently on loan at Stellenbosch FC from Orlando Pirates until the end of June.

Once his loan deal concludes:

  • He will become a free agent
  • He can sign with any club from 1 July
  • Multiple teams are already monitoring his situation

This places Mabasa in a strong negotiating position ahead of the transfer window.


Background / Why Clubs Are Interested

Mabasa has already proven his quality in South African football.

  • He finished as a top goal scorer in the Betway Premiership with 16 goals just two seasons ago
  • His goal-scoring ability makes him a reliable attacking option
  • Limited game time at Pirates has been linked more to contractual factors than performance

For clubs seeking a proven striker, his profile offers both experience and value.

Why Kaizer Chiefs Are Interested

Kaizer Chiefs have already strengthened their attack this season with:

  • Etiosa Ighodaro
  • Khanyisa Mayo
  • Flavio da Silva

However:

  • Mayo’s future remains uncertain due to his loan status
  • Goal output has been inconsistent

Mabasa’s proven scoring record makes him a strong candidate to add depth and reliability to the squad.
